News & events News Megan Ward, Master of Energy Change Publication date Friday, 28 Oct 2016 Body “I’m doing the Master of Energy Change part-time in conjunction with working for the ACT Government, and I’m finding the program very flexible and accommodating. It’s also a great fit with what I’m doing and is informing how I do my job. In my work I’ve recently taken on the temporary role of Manager, Solar Storage Policy. I had been focusing on battery storage in my studies, and I really believe that without undertaking this as part of my Masters, I wouldn’t have the knowledge to do the role.
